Transaction 51fc2bf43a39b3444425b1ace95f30172f22f7ea91a17efd4fde9338a246ba86
1 Input
2 Outputs
- 51fc2bf43a39b3444425b1ace95f30172f22f7ea91a17efd4fde9338a246ba86:0
- 51fc2bf43a39b3444425b1ace95f30172f22f7ea91a17efd4fde9338a246ba86:1
value 1294270
address 11i3eCn19jaN2pcC7i62zmahFa2kahT6g
value 2364643
address 1HXemgL1SBVx6HgmC4VoTA87QEe8EnJCNh